Bitcoin Strategy Pause: Increasing Cash Reserves Amid Market Uncertainty

Key Takeaways

  • MicroStrategy pauses Bitcoin purchases and raises cash reserves to $2.19 billion as of December 22, 2025.
  • The company raised $748 million via common share sales during the week ending December 21, following nearly $2 billion invested in Bitcoin earlier that month.
  • Hedging concerns arise amid a 30% Bitcoin price fall since October peak and a 50% decline in MicroStrategy’s share price.

MicroStrategy Inc., the Virginia-based business intelligence firm renowned for its aggressive Bitcoin accumulation, has halted new Bitcoin acquisitions as of December 22, 2025. Instead, it is prioritizing building cash reserves, which now total approximately $2.19 billion. This strategic pause and capital raise reflect a hedging response against ongoing cryptocurrency volatility and investor uncertainty.

MicroStrategy’s Strategic Pause and Capital Raise

According to a recent SEC filing, MicroStrategy sold $748 million worth of common shares during the week ending December 21, 2025. This fundraising follows nearly $2 billion the company deployed on Bitcoin over the preceding two weeks, bringing total Bitcoin holdings to an estimated $60 billion. The firm also established a $1.4 billion reserve earmarked for upcoming dividend and interest payments.

This financial cushion directly addresses mounting concerns that MicroStrategy may face pressured Bitcoin liquidations if market prices deteriorate further. Bitcoin’s steep 30% decline from its early October peak has coincided with MicroStrategy’s shares plunging by over half their value. These dynamics weigh on investor confidence and the company’s ability to maintain its historically strong Bitcoin-backed valuation premium.

Market Context and Hedging Imperatives

Bitcoin’s persistent price slump has driven widespread selloffs in crypto-linked equities, with MicroStrategy among the hardest hit. Its market Net Asset Value (mNAV)—a key indicator comparing enterprise value against Bitcoin holdings—stood at roughly 1.1 on December 22, signaling caution among shareholders. Some analysts fear this metric could soon fall below one, eroding the premium that once supported MicroStrategy’s stock price.

In response, MicroStrategy is adopting a hedging posture by halting Bitcoin purchases and bolstering liquidity. Accumulating cash reserves aims to enable the company to navigate protracted market stress without forced asset sales. This strategy reflects a calibrated balance: maintaining confidence in Bitcoin’s long-term potential while managing near-term downside risks amid uncertain macroeconomic and regulatory environments.

Hedging: Market Outlook for MicroStrategy and Bitcoin

Raising over $700 million through equity sales and setting aside $1.4 billion for financial obligations strongly underscore MicroStrategy’s commitment to risk mitigation. As Bitcoin faces significant headwinds in the broader financial landscape, this tactical pause illustrates prudent capital preservation.

Investors will closely monitor whether MicroStrategy resumes Bitcoin buying or if this marks a longer-term strategic adjustment. For now, the move represents a clear hedging response to recent market turmoil, balancing exposure and liquidity as 2025 concludes.
